Block Pavers Installation in Norwalk, CT
Block pavers installation involves placing interlocking bricks or stones to create durable, attractive surfaces for driveways, walkways, patios, and other outdoor areas. This service covers a variety of project sizes and styles, allowing property owners to customize the appearance and functionality of their outdoor spaces. Before requesting block pavers installation, homeowners typically want to understand the different patterns, colors, and materials available, as well as the overall durability and maintenance requirements of the pavers.
Property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the area, drainage needs, and existing landscape conditions when planning for block pavers. It is also helpful to inquire about the preparation process, including excavation and base work, to ensure a stable foundation. Understanding the scope of work, including any necessary permits or site adjustments, can assist in making informed decisions and achieving a long-lasting, visually appealing result.

Block Pavers Installation Questions
What types of projects are suitable for block pavers? Block pavers are ideal for driveways, walkways, patios, and outdoor seating areas, providing durability and visual appeal.
How long does a typical block paver installation take? Installation times vary based on project size and complexity, but generally, it can be completed within a few days.
Are block pavers su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, block pavers are designed to withstand heavy foot and vehicle traffic, making them a practical choice for busy outdoor spaces.
What should property owners consider before installing block pavers? It's important to assess the existing surface, drainage needs, and the desired design to ensure a proper and lasting installation.
